Transaction df31fc676ce2f5cee14533a5b92e2a82a7a6d81b159cae1b44db9c41a66ce672
2 Input
2 Outputs
- df31fc676ce2f5cee14533a5b92e2a82a7a6d81b159cae1b44db9c41a66ce672:0
- df31fc676ce2f5cee14533a5b92e2a82a7a6d81b159cae1b44db9c41a66ce672:1
value 28908
address 1GdAqHaAnLGY3FZLHcSzfJfMnra8DXmakx
value 851761
address 1LbUH6bE3FFPAsE1J3YnN3Kn4NKh8Z3Ne3